Governance is a key element of the service value system—that is, the way you create and deliver value to your customers. The ISO/IEC 38500:2015 standard for governance of IT departments and organizations defines IT governance as the system by which the current and future use of IT is directed and controlled.
According to ITIL® 4, this direction usually comes in two forms: strategies and policies.

Policies are the framework and constraints (guardrails) within which employees can strive for individual and collective success. ISO vocabulary defines a policy as:
"Intentions and direction of an organization, as formally expressed by its top management."

The golden rule in governance has long been that we cannot outsource oversight.
Most organizations embracing digital transformation have outsourced the need to maintain IT infrastructure and platforms—this used to take up significant policy effort. Depending on your organization’s maturity, you may no longer need many I&O policies, for instance.
If you do have a cloud strategy, it’s likely that your policy focus has shifted to service and data layers. This is where most interaction with technology is now happening, especially when it comes to app development. But that doesn’t mean that you can neglect the underlying layers. Instead, you’ll likely pivot to areas like security and billing.
(Interestingly, most modern app development approaches align to the agile manifesto, which de-emphasizes rigid processes and comprehensive documentation—two elements that are traditionally the bedrock of policies.)

The intention of a change management policy is to maximize the number of successful service and product changes by ensuring that you’re properly assessing risk, authorizing changes to proceed, and managing the change schedule. (In ITIL 4, this policy is renamed to change enablement.)
The policy defines:
Without this policy, risks of unplanned service disruption or bureaucratic hurdles to smooth change execution are likely to occur (exactly when you don’t need them).

This policy spells out the required posture to secure the availability, integrity and confidentiality of business information on IT systems from potential risks, through appropriate controls that align with organizational and regulatory requirements.

The Enterprise Architecture policy outlines how IT supports the business mission and operations, through alignment and prioritization of IT strategies and initiatives. It also includes guidelines for designing, planning, implementing, and governing enterprise IT architecture.
Without this policy, your organization risks increased costs and poor performance.

This policy focuses on the management and governance of data assets—i.e., documents, databases, and application data files—with a strong focus on data protection and privacy.
A key data management component is the data classification policy, a formal framework for categorizing and managing data.
The heart of a data classification policy is to sort data according to its sensitivity, its value, and the impact that altering, destroying, or disclosing it to unauthorized parties would have.
Organizations can then apply the right protections based on these characteristics. Public data needs little protection, whereas more sensitive internal, confidential, and restricted data needs more protection.
Protecting data is important, but so is demonstrating compliance with regulations and security frameworks. You may need to show how you have used, managed, and protected data in adherence to legal requirements and standards. This also shows customers and partners that your systems are trustworthy.
Lastly, your data classification policy helps you efficiently use resources to reduce security risks to your data and systems. Instead of treating all data as equal, you can focus on protecting the most sensitive data.
Without this policy, you’re risking the misuse, loss, regulatory penalties, or lost opportunity from data usage.

This policy provides guidelines on activities involved in the asset lifecycle, from acquisition, tagging, deployment, usage, maintenance, withdrawal, and disposal.
Absence of this policy would impact the organization financially because you’re not maximizing the ROI of your assets—and you may even be taking a loss.
